GE Olympic Works Centre

To celebrate GE's sponsorship of the 2012 Olympics, we built a GE Works Centre at the German Gymnasium in King's Cross, London. The GE Works Centre served as an immersive environment hosting special events, presentations, game viewings, executive meetings and also included an interactive product gallery highlighting GE's latest technologies. I worked with a wide range of GE businesses to research and curate interactive experiences that represented the full breadth of the brand. These experiences took form as a high definition LED mesh on the building's exterior, scaled models of machines, multi-touch surfaces, a holographic projection, custom furnishings, exhibition displays and walls, a reception, a cafe/bar, lighting, and sound design.
